Output 8f6b39fa09755706c49ba93ec375394c55398a70bf340235182ba127284c1818:30

value
1512140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9b6cd184713e9f94e2cb07b829e1f69da6ec9e OP_EQUAL
address
3EWUiXJkdGiaxhafeq7Kw5GPx7PK6Abaea
transaction
8f6b39fa09755706c49ba93ec375394c55398a70bf340235182ba127284c1818
confirmations
266824
spent
true